clutch problems..
So i recently bought a 01 ws6 6 speed. This is my second 6 speed car. It seems that after a day or two of hard driving i loose clutch presure and have to fill up the clutch reservor with brake fluid. I would think that this means the slave cylender is going out but the car doesnt leak a drop of fluid? I also can not down shift into first gear without it grinding really bad, but if i stop and shift into second than first it works just fine? He told me the dealer rebuilt the trany a few years prior and that it had been like that since he owned it. any help would be appreciated thanks...

Try not to drive it until the issue is fixed. A dragging clutch (likely caused by the slave leaking, as mentioned) creates excessive wear on internal transmission components, which is not good.
Many times the slave will leak and puddle fluid inside the bellhousing, and then it runs out when you are driving. Thats probably the reason you're not seeing a visible leak.
